Home > ASP Development > ODBC error while connecting to database

ODBC error while connecting to database



<i><b>Originally posted by : Mona</b></i><br />Hi,<br /><br />What does this error mean?<br /><br />I get this error message when I try to connect to database(oracle), on my PC (NT workstation).<br /><br />Microsoft OLE DB Provider for ODBC Drivers error '80004005' <br /><br />[Microsoft][ODBC Driver Manager] Data source name not found and no default driver specified <br /><br />/programs/dblist.asp, line 9 <br /><br />I am using this program to connect to database.<br /><br /><%<br />MYDSN="DSN=LOCAL1;UID=SCOTT;PWD=TIGER"<br />MYSQL="SELECT ENAME FROM EMP"<br />' DISPLAY A DATABASE FIELD AS A LISTBOX<br />SET CONNTEMP=SERVER.CREATEOBJECT("ADODB.CONNECTION")<br />CONNTEMP.OPEN MYDSN<br />SET RSTEMP=CONNTEMP.EXECUTE(MYSQL)<br />IF RSTEMP.EOF THEN<br />RESPONSE.WRITE "NO DATA FOR<BR>"<br />RESPONSE.WRITE MYSQL<br />CONNTEMP.CLOSE<br />SET CONNTEMP=NOTHING<br />RESPONSE.END<br />END IF<br />%><br /><FORM ACTION="dblistrespond.ASP"METHOD="POST"><br /><SELECT NAME="ENAME"><br /><%<br />'NOW LETS GRAB ALL THE DATA<br />DO UNTIL RSTEMP.EOF %><br /><OPTION> <%=RSTEMP(0)%> </OPTION><br /><%<br />RSTEMP.MOVENEXT<br />LOOP<br /><br />RSTEMP.CLOSE<br />SET RSTEMP=NOTHING<br />CONNTEMP.CLOSE<br />SET CONNTEMP=NOTHING<br />%><br /><INPUT TYPE="SUBMIT" VALUE="Choose Employee Name"><br /></SELECT></FORM><br /></BODY></HTML><br /><br />Thanks<br /><br />

    
Guest


<i><b>Originally posted by : steve</b></i><br />http://www.activeserverpages.com/learn/dsn1.asp here is an article how to setup Data Source Names. If your using Oracle I'd make sure you have the latest mdac. Microsoft data access components. if unsure u can download the latest at http://www.microsoft.com/data/ get at least 2.1.2. <br /><br />steve<br /><br /><br />------------<br />Mona at 2/15/2000 9:10:39 AM<br /><br />Hi,<br /><br />What does this error mean?<br /><br />I get this error message when I try to connect to database(oracle), on my PC (NT workstation).<br /><br />Microsoft OLE DB Provider for ODBC Drivers error '80004005' <br /><br />[Microsoft][ODBC Driver Manager] Data source name not found and no default driver specified <br /><br />/programs/dblist.asp, line 9 <br /><br />I am using this program to connect to database.<br /><br /><%<br />MYDSN="DSN=LOCAL1;UID=SCOTT;PWD=TIGER"<br />MYSQL="SELECT ENAME FROM EMP"<br />' DISPLAY A DATABASE FIELD AS A LISTBOX<br />SET CONNTEMP=SERVER.CREATEOBJECT("ADODB.CONNECTION")<br />CONNTEMP.OPEN MYDSN<br />SET RSTEMP=CONNTEMP.EXECUTE(MYSQL)<br />IF RSTEMP.EOF THEN<br />RESPONSE.WRITE "NO DATA FOR<BR>"<br />RESPONSE.WRITE MYSQL<br />CONNTEMP.CLOSE<br />SET CONNTEMP=NOTHING<br />RESPONSE.END<br />END IF<br />%><br /><FORM ACTION="dblistrespond.ASP"METHOD="POST"><br /><SELECT NAME="ENAME"><br /><%<br />'NOW LETS GRAB ALL THE DATA<br />DO UNTIL RSTEMP.EOF %><br /><OPTION> <%=RSTEMP(0)%> </OPTION><br /><%<br />RSTEMP.MOVENEXT<br />LOOP<br /><br />RSTEMP.CLOSE<br />SET RSTEMP=NOTHING<br />CONNTEMP.CLOSE<br />SET CONNTEMP=NOTHING<br />%><br /><INPUT TYPE="SUBMIT" VALUE="Choose Employee Name"><br /></SELECT></FORM><br /></BODY></HTML><br /><br />Thanks<br /><br />

Was this answer helpful ? Yes No   
Guest
 
 
Home - About Infoqu - Contact - Privacy Statement - Link to Infoqu - Bookmark Infoqu

Copyright 2007-2008 by Infoqu. All rights reserved